Uses of Interface
com.flowable.platform.api.repository.QueryDefinitionModel
Packages that use QueryDefinitionModel
Package
Description
-
Uses of QueryDefinitionModel in com.flowable.indexing.query.builder.standard
Methods in com.flowable.indexing.query.builder.standard with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ionprotected StandardDataQueryBuilderStandardDataQueryTransformerServiceImpl.createQueryBuilder(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load) com.fasterxml.jackson.databind.JsonNodeStandardDataQueryTransformerService.transformToElasticsearchQuery(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load) Transforms the givenQueryDefinitionModelto an Elasticsearch JSON query, using the provided payload.com.fasterxml.jackson.databind.JsonNodeStandardDataQueryTransformerServiceImpl.transformToElasticsearchQuery(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load) StandardDataQueryTransformerService.transformToElasticsearchQueryBuilder(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load) Similar toStandardDataQueryTransformerService.transformToElasticsearchQuery(QueryDefinitionModel, Map), but doesn't yet build the JSON for the query.StandardDataQueryTransformerServiceImpl.transformToElasticsearchQueryBuilder(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load) protected StandardDataQueryConfigurationStandardDataQueryTransformerServiceImpl.validateQueryDefinitionModel(QueryDefinitionModel queryDefinitionModel) -
Uses of QueryDefinitionModel in com.flowable.platform.api.repository
Classes in com.flowable.platform.api.repository that implement QueryDefinitionModelMethods in com.flowable.platform.api.repository that return QueryDefinitionModelModifier and TypeMethodDescriptionQueryResourceConverter.convertQueryResourceToModel(byte[] queryResourceBytes) QueryResourceConverter.convertQueryResourceToModel(com.fasterxml.jackson.databind.JsonNode queryJsonNode) QueryResourceConverter.convertQueryResourceToModel(InputStream queryResourceStream) PlatformRepositoryService.getQueryDefinitionModel(String queryDefinitionId) Returns theQueryDefinitionModelincluding all query model info.PlatformRepositoryService.getQueryDefinitionModelByKey(String QueryDefinitionKey) Returns theQueryDefinitionModelincluding all query model info, using the query definition key and resolving the key to the latest version.PlatformRepositoryService.getQueryDefinitionModelByKeyAndTenantId(String QueryDefinitionKey, String tenantId) Returns theQueryDefinitionModelincluding all query model info, using the query definition key and resolving the key to the latest version.Methods in com.flowable.platform.api.repository with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ionQueryResourceConverter.convertQueryDefinitionModelToJson(QueryDefinitionModel queryDefinitionModel) -
Uses of QueryDefinitionModel in com.flowable.platform.engine.impl.cmd
Methods in com.flowable.platform.engine.impl.cmd that return QueryDefinitionModelModifier and TypeMethodDescriptionGetQueryDefinitionModelCmd.execute(CommandContext commandContext) -
Uses of QueryDefinitionModel in com.flowable.platform.engine.impl.deployer
Methods in com.flowable.platform.engine.impl.deployer that return QueryDefinitionModelModifier and TypeMethodDescriptionQueryResourceConverterImpl.convertQueryResourceToModel(byte[] appResourceBytes) QueryResourceConverterImpl.convertQueryResourceToModel(com.fasterxml.jackson.databind.JsonNode queryJsonNode) QueryResourceConverterImpl.convertQueryResourceToModel(InputStream appResourceStream) Methods in com.flowable.platform.engine.impl.deployer with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ionQueryResourceConverterImpl.convertQueryDefinitionModelToJson(QueryDefinitionModel queryDefinitionModel) protected voidQueryDefinitionDeployer.updateCachingAndArtifacts(QueryDefinitionEntity queryDefinition, QueryDefinitionModel queryResourceModel, PlatformDeploymentEntity deployment) -
Uses of QueryDefinitionModel in com.flowable.platform.engine.impl.persistence.deploy
Fields in com.flowable.platform.engine.impl.persistence.deploy declared as QueryDefinitionModelModifier and TypeFieldDescriptionprotected QueryDefinitionModelQueryDefinitionCacheEntry.queryDefinitionModelMethods in com.flowable.platform.engine.impl.persistence.deploy that return QueryDefinitionModelMethods in com.flowable.platform.engine.impl.persistence.deploy with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ionvoidQueryDefinitionCacheEntry.setQueryDefinitionModel(QueryDefinitionModel queryDefinitionModel) Constructors in com.flowable.platform.engine.impl.persistence.deploy with parameters of type QueryDefinitionModelModifierConstructorDescriptionQueryDefinitionCacheEntry(QueryDefinitionEntity queryDefinitionEntity, QueryDefinitionModel queryDefinitionModel) -
Uses of QueryDefinitionModel in com.flowable.platform.engine.impl.repository
Methods in com.flowable.platform.engine.impl.repository that return QueryDefinitionModelModifier and TypeMethodDescriptionPlatformRepositoryServiceImpl.getQueryDefinitionModel(String queryDefinitionId) PlatformRepositoryServiceImpl.getQueryDefinitionModelByKey(String queryDefinitionKey) PlatformRepositoryServiceImpl.getQueryDefinitionModelByKeyAndTenantId(String queryDefinitionKey, String tenantId) -
Uses of QueryDefinitionModel in com.flowable.platform.service.dashboard.resultmapper
Methods in com.flowable.platform.service.dashboard.resultmapper with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ionDashboardComponentQueryResultMapperService.applyQueryResultMapping(DashboardComponentDefinitionModel dashboardComponentDefinitionModel, Q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load, com.fasterxml.jackson.databind.JsonNode result) DashboardComponentQueryResultMapperService.extractAggregationNamesAndTypes(QueryDefinitionModel queryDefinitionModel) -
Uses of QueryDefinitionModel in com.flowable.platform.service.dashboard.transformer
Methods in com.flowable.platform.service.dashboard.transformer with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ionprotected booleanQueryResultToCsvTransformerServiceImpl.isCaseInstancesQuery(QueryDefinitionModel queryDefinitionModel) protected booleanQueryResultToCsvTransformerServiceImpl.isProcessInstancesQuery(QueryDefinitionModel queryDefinitionModel) protected booleanQueryResultToCsvTransformerServiceImpl.isTasksQuery(QueryDefinitionModel queryDefinitionModel) voidQueryResultToCsvTransformerService.transformQueryDataToCSV(Dashboard dashboard, QueryDefinitionModel queryDefinitionModel, DashboardComponentDefinitionModel dashboardComponentD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load, OutputStream outputStream) voidQueryResultToCsvTransformerServiceImpl.transformQueryDataToCSV(Dashboard dashboard, QueryDefinitionModel queryDefinitionModel, DashboardComponentDefinitionModel dashboardComponentD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load, OutputStream outputStream) -
Uses of QueryDefinitionModel in com.flowable.platform.service.index
Methods in com.flowable.platform.service.index that return QueryDefinitionModelModifier and TypeMethodDescriptionprotected QueryDefinitionModelWorkIndexService.getTemplateDefinition(String queryKey) Methods in com.flowable.platform.service.index with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ionprotected booleanWorkIndexService.isCustomQuery(QueryDefinitionModel queryModel) protected booleanWorkIndexService.isSafeQuery(QueryDefinitionModel queryModel) protected StringWorkIndexService.processCustomQueryTemplate(QueryDefinitionModel queryModel, Map<String, Object> payload) protected com.fasterxml.jackson.databind.node.ObjectNodeWorkIndexService.processSafeQueryTemplate(QueryDefinitionModel queryModel, Map<String, Object> payload) protected <T> Page<T>WorkIndexService.queryWithCustomQuery(String index, PlatformIndexQueryRequest request, QueryDefinitionModel queryModel, ElasticsearchResultConverter.ResultMapper<T> jsonMapper) protected <RES,REQ extends PlatformIndexQueryRequest, Q extends PlatformIndexQueryBuilder<REQ>>
Page<RES>WorkIndexService.queryWithSafeQuery(REQ request, String index, QueryDefinitionModel queryModel, ElasticsearchResultConverter.ResultMapper<RES> jsonMapper, Supplier<Q> queryBuilderSupplier) -
Uses of QueryDefinitionModel in com.flowable.platform.service.query
Methods in com.flowable.platform.service.query that return QueryDefinitionModelModifier and TypeMethodDescriptionQueryService.getQueryDefinitionModel(String queryDefinitionKey, String tenantId) QueryServiceImpl.getQueryDefinitionModel(String queryDefinitionKey, String tenantId) -
Uses of QueryDefinitionModel in com.flowable.platform.service.query.datatable
Methods in com.flowable.platform.service.query.datatable with parameters of type QueryDefinitionModelModifier and TypeMethodDescriptionDataTableConverterImpl.convertESResultToDataTableData(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load, com.fasterxml.jackson.databind.JsonNode queryResult) DataTableDataConverter.convertESResultToDataTableData(QueryDefinitionModel queryDefinitionModel, Map<String, com.fasterxml.jackson.databind.JsonNode> queryPayload, com.fasterxml.jackson.databind.JsonNode esQueryResult)